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present application belongs to the technical field of disconnectors, and particularly relates to a 10kV outdoor disconnector contact and disconnector. BACKGROUND

[0002] The disconnector is a high-voltage electrical appliance for switching on and off the circuit without load current, and is used for changing the circuit connection or isolating the line or device from the power supply. At present, the 10kV outdoor disconnector used in the transformer substation in China is of double-column simultaneous opening and closing type, and the rotating mode is to rotate the porcelain column, and the connection mode is to use the spring self-pressing type. This kind of disconnector has complex structure, and the rotating and connecting parts are not in good contact, which often causes the phenomena of heating and sparking, and welding. Long-term thermal expansion and cold contraction also cause the stress change of the porcelain column, and the porcelain column is often broken when the knife switch is pulled out. Since it is a double-column rotating opening and closing type, it is difficult to master during maintenance and debugging. When the 10kV disconnector of double-column opening and closing type is debugged, the synchronism between the two columns and the phase-to-phase synchronism need to be debugged. Once the foundation changes slightly or after multiple operations, the contact is poor and sparks.

[0003] In addition, at present, most of the outdoor 10KV disconnectors use self-type spring pressing, which is easy to deform and lose elasticity under the condition of long-term overcurrent heating. Since it is operated outdoors, rainwater causes spring rust, which eventually leads to an increase in contact resistance at the connection, causing the entire connection part to heat and spark. SUMMARY

[0004] In view of the problems of complex structure, unreasonable contact and difficult debugging of the existing outdoor 10kV disconnector, the present application aims to provide a 10kV outdoor disconnector contact and disconnector. The 10kV disconnector of the present application has simple structure, labor-saving operation, good current conduction, convenient debugging, good contact, and effectively prevents the heating problem of the disconnector. The single-phase pull rod is cancelled, and the connection of the incoming and outgoing lines becomes simple, the cost is low, and the safety and reliability of production and use are improved.

[0005]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the technical scheme adopted by the present application is as follows:

[0006] A 10kV outdoor disconnector contact, characterized in that the contact comprises:

[0007] a moving contact;

[0008] a static contact, the static contact comprising a screw assembly, a contact finger head and a spring ring, the contact finger head being inwardly bent to form a hook, and the spring ring being sleeved on the hook;

[0009] a connecting piece, one end of the connecting piece being a hexagonal body, and six faces of the hexagonal body being connected with one contact finger head through the screw assembly respectively.

[0010] Further, the contact further comprises a rain cover, the rain cover comprises a cover body and a fixing body, the cover body is fixed on the connecting piece through the fixing body, and the cover body is used for covering the static contact.

[0011] Further, one end of the moving contact is a plane body, the other end is a semicircular spherical body, and the middle part is a cylindrical body, and the semicircular spherical body is screwed on the cylindrical body.

[0012] Further, the other end of the connecting piece is a plane body, and a screw hole is arranged on the plane body.

[0013] The application further comprises a 10kV outdoor isolating switch, characterized in that the isolating switch comprises:

[0014] The contact;

[0015] The fixed porcelain column part;

[0016] The rotating porcelain column part;

[0017] The base part;

[0018] And the operating part;

[0019] The contact is arranged between the fixed porcelain column part and the rotating porcelain column part, the base part supports the fixed porcelain column part and the rotating porcelain column part, and the operating part is installed below the rotating porcelain column part.

[0020] Further, the fixed porcelain column part comprises a fixed porcelain column, a wiring board and a connecting seat, the wiring board is fixed at the top end of the fixed porcelain column, the wiring board is used for connecting the connecting piece, and the connecting seat is arranged at the bottom of the fixed porcelain column.

[0021] Further, the rotating porcelain column part comprises a rotating porcelain column, a conductive plate and a base, the conductive plate is arranged at the top end of the rotating porcelain column, the conductive plate is used for connecting the moving contact, and the base is arranged at the bottom of the rotating porcelain column.

[0022] Further, the base part comprises a cross iron, and the cross iron is provided with perforations at two ends, and is used for installing the fixed porcelain column part and the rotating porcelain column part.

[0023] Further, the operating part comprises an operating rod, a clamp, a bearing and a bearing cover.

[0024] The application has the beneficial effects that:

[0025] 1. The application is a single-column rotating isolating switch, and each phase is driven to be opened and closed at the same time, so that the connection of the moving contact and the static contact is facilitated.

[0026] 2. The moving contact is cylindrical, the static contact is six-petal plum blossom type, the connection mode is horizontal insertion, and the cylindrical surface connection can effectively clamp and prevent heating caused by poor contact.

[0027] 3. The isolating switch of the application greatly reduces the weight of the overall switch, simplifies the structure, improves the opening and closing quality, prevents heating, achieves the purpose of safe and efficient production, saves production cost, and improves enterprise benefit. [0037] Figure 10 is the structure diagram of the operating part.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0038] The specific embodiments of the application will be described in detail below in combination with the technical solutions and drawings.

[0039] The structure of the 10kV outdoor high-voltage isolating switch of the application is three-phase type, each phase structure is the same, and is linked through an inter-phase pull rod assembly.

[0040] As shown in Figures 2-6 , the 10kV outdoor isolating switch contact includes a moving contact 1, a static contact 3, and a connecting piece 4.

[0041] The one end of the moving contact 1 is a flat body 1.1 for connecting the conducting plate, and the other end is a half-sphere alloy head 1.4 which can be inserted into the contact finger head 3.2 of the static contact 3. The middle part of the moving contact 1 is a cylinder 1.2, and the half-sphere alloy head 1.4 is copper alloy and is screwed on the screw body 1.3 at one end of the cylinder 1.2. The surface of the flat body 1.1 is provided with screw holes for screwing the conducting plate and the moving contact.

[0042] The 10kV outdoor isolating switch contact further comprises a rainproof cover 2 in the shape of a horn, including a cover body 2.1 and a fixing body 2.2. The cover body 2 is fixed on the connecting piece 4 through the fixing body 2.2, and is used for covering the static contact 3 to prevent rainwater from entering.

[0043] The static contact 3 comprises a screw assembly 3.1, a contact finger head 3.2 and a spring ring 3.3. The contact finger head 3.2 is six in number, and the screw assembly 3.1 fixes the six contact finger heads 3.2 on the hexagonal body 4.1 of the connecting piece 4. The contact finger head 3.2 is copper alloy and is in the shape of a hook, with the inner side being in the shape of a circular arc. The six contact finger heads 3.2 form a circular static contact, and the contact finger heads 3.2 are inwardly curved and can be sleeved into the spring ring 3.3. The spring ring 3.3 is a non-opening rustproof circular spring ring and can be sleeved into the inwardly curved hook of the static contact 3.

[0044] One end of the connecting piece 4 is a hexagonal body 4.1, the other end is a flat body 4.3, and the middle part is a cylinder 4.2. The cylinder 4.2 is provided with fixing holes for fixing the rainproof cover. The hexagonal body 4.1 has six contact finger fixing planes 4.1.1, each of which is provided with a contact finger fixing hole 4.1.2 for fixing the static contact 3. The flat body 4.3 is also provided with screw holes for screwing the terminal plate 3.

[0045] As shown in Figure 1 The 10kV outdoor isolating switch of the present application comprises the 10kV outdoor isolating switch contact a as described above, and further comprises a fixed porcelain column part b, a rotating porcelain column part c, a base part d and a operating part e.

[0046] The contact a is arranged between the fixed porcelain column part b and the rotating porcelain column part c, the base part d supports the fixed porcelain column part b and the rotating porcelain column part c, and the operating part e is installed below the rotating porcelain column part c.

[0047] As shown in Figure 7 The fixed porcelain column part b comprises a terminal assembly 5, a bolt assembly 6, a fixed porcelain column 7, a terminal plate 8, a connecting seat 9 and a screw assembly 10.

[0048] The main body of the fixed porcelain column part b is a fixed porcelain column 7, the terminal board 8 is fixed at the top end of the fixed porcelain column 7, the terminal board 8 is used to connect the connecting piece 4, and the connecting seat 9 is arranged at the bottom of the fixed porcelain column 7. The terminal board 8 is provided with a terminal assembly 5, the terminal assembly 5 is a cover plate or a cap, the terminal assembly 5 is provided with a cavity, a bolt assembly 6 is penetrated into the cavity, and the bolt assembly 6 is matched with a threaded hole on the fixed porcelain column 7, so that the terminal board 8 is fixed at the top end of the fixed porcelain column 7. The terminal board 8 is a copper bar, both ends of the copper bar are provided with threaded holes, one end of the copper bar is connected with a wire through a bolt assembly, and the other end of the copper bar is connected with the connecting piece 4 of the contact a through a bolt assembly. The connecting seat 9 is arranged at the bottom of the fixed porcelain column 7 and is connected with the base part d through a screw assembly 10.

[0049] As shown in the drawings, the rotating porcelain column part c comprises a terminal assembly 11, a bolt assembly 12, a bearing cover 13, a bearing 14, a nut 15, a nail 16, a soft copper strip 17, a bolt assembly 18, a conductive plate 19, a rotating porcelain column 20, a bolt assembly 21, a base 22 and a flange plate 23. [0050] The conductive plate 19 is arranged at the top end of the rotating porcelain column 20, and the conductive plate 19 is used to connect the movable contact 1. The base 22 is arranged at the bottom of the rotating porcelain column 20.

[0051] The bearing cover 13 is a copper circular shape, the lower part of the bearing cover 13 is provided with a threaded hole, and the bearing cover 13 is pressed and connected at the top of the rotating porcelain column 20 through the cooperation of the bolt assembly 18 and the threaded hole.

[0052] The bearing 14 is arranged in the bearing cover 13, and the upper part of the bearing cover 13 is provided with an opening.

[0053] The terminal assembly 11 is a T-shaped structure, one end of the terminal assembly 11 is a flat surface, a wire is connected into the terminal assembly 11 through the bolt assembly 12, and the soft copper strip 17 is connected to the conductive plate 19. The other end of the terminal assembly 11 is a cylindrical shape and is provided with a thread, penetrates into the upper opening of the bearing cover 13 and is matched and connected with the bearing 14. The nut 15 locks the bearing 14 in the bearing cover 13.

[0054] The nail 16 penetrates through the cylindrical end of the terminal assembly 11 and clamps the nut 15.

[0055] The soft copper strip 17 is made of copper and can be two, and a length is reserved for the rotating porcelain column 20 to rotate. The two ends of the soft copper strip 17 are respectively connected to the flat end of the terminal assembly 11 and the conductive plate 19 through the bolt assembly 12.

[0056] The conductive plate 19 is made of copper, one end of the conductive plate 19 is pressed and connected with the top of the rotating porcelain column 20 through the bolt assembly 18. The other end of the conductive plate 19 is provided with a threaded hole and is used to connect with the flat body 1.1 of the movable contact 1.​

[0057] Bolt assembly 21 connects base 22 to flange 23 below.

[0058] The flange 23 is provided with a pull cylinder 24, which is used to connect the tie rod assemblies between each phase.

[0059] like Figure 9 As shown, the base portion d includes a horizontal iron 25, and the two ends of the horizontal iron 25 are provided with through holes 26 for installing the fixed ceramic column portion b and the rotating ceramic column portion c.

[0060] A number of fixing holes 27 are provided around the perforation 26. The fixing holes 27 cooperate with the screw assembly 10 to fasten the connecting seat 9 of the fixed ceramic column part b. The fixing holes 27 cooperate with the bolt assembly 21 to fasten the flange 23 of the rotating ceramic column part c.

[0061] like Figure 10 As shown, the operating part e is disposed on the base part d and includes a bearing cover 28, a bearing 29, a bolt assembly 30, a through pin 31, an operating lever 32, a clamp 33, and a three-phase tie rod assembly 34.

[0062] A bearing cover 28 is fastened to the horizontal iron 25 of the base portion d by bolt assembly 30. A bearing 29 is installed inside the bearing cover 28. The bearing cover 28, the bearing 29, and the fittings and clamps 33 of the flange 23 cooperate with each other. The operating rod 32 is inserted into the fitting of the flange 23 and fixed by through bolt 31.

[0063] The three-phase tie rod assembly 34 is a segmented bent linkage screw. The tie rod assembly 34 is sleeved onto the pulling cylinder 24, which is welded to a suitable position on the flange 23. The middle tie rod in the tie rod assembly 34 is a double-threaded rod, and one end of the tie rod assembly has a semi-circular bend, connected to the pulling cylinder 24 of the other ceramic column flange 23 by a screw. During operation, the rotation of the operating lever 32 in the operating part causes the tie rod assembly 34 to move under the action of the flange 23. Simultaneously, the other two movable ceramic columns also rotate, resulting in the simultaneous opening and closing of the three-phase moving contacts.

[0064] The opening and closing of the 10kV outdoor disconnector of this invention is achieved as follows: When the disconnector needs to be operated, the operating lever 32 is rotated. The operating lever 32 drives the rotating porcelain column, and the pull rod assembly 34 rotates together with the rotating porcelain column, driving the other two phase porcelain columns to rotate as well. Under the action of the rotating porcelain column, the three-phase moving contacts can be inserted or pulled out of the stationary contacts between each phase, achieving the purpose of effective synchronous opening and closing of the three phases. The opening and closing of the high-voltage disconnector is completed by the rotation of a single column.

[0065] The double-column rotation of outdoor 10kV high-voltage disconnecting switch is changed into single-column rotation, and after installation, the debugging of inter-phase pull rod assembly can be directly debugged to complete the debugging work.

[0066] The structure of the present 10kV disconnecting switch omits the assembly of three sets of inter-phase pull rod assemblies and three bearing seats, and the contact type contact is changed into plug-in type contact, which fundamentally changes the current passing mode, the action mode and the contact mode of the disconnecting switch. The in-and-out line current is changed into soft copper belt current guide. Therefore, not only the production cost is greatly saved and the product price is reduced, but more importantly, the on-site debugging time of the product is reduced, the debugging is simplified, the heating of the connection and the porcelain column is prevented, the porcelain column is prevented from being pulled off, the heating of each connection part is prevented, and the safe operation of the disconnecting switch is ensured.
